Output 8c3760abdd4bc046cdff74536357eb5b6ef436e2830cbbeec3e95827f58ffb2b:0

value
29112681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 645c58031833564fe845024b41e613d79042c01c OP_EQUAL
address
3Aqg7tMoFXeWTbCdFVocZ2dQQkCX2QrJdT
transaction
8c3760abdd4bc046cdff74536357eb5b6ef436e2830cbbeec3e95827f58ffb2b
spent
true